Quote:Any Wisconsin business that can safely provide curbside drop-off services will be allowed to do so under updated COVID-19-related business restrictions announced Monday by Gov. Tony Evers.



Quote:The new order announced Monday goes into effect at 8 a.m. Wednesday and allows all businesses in the state to provide curbside pickup and drop-off of goods and animals, including dog groomers, small engine repair shops and upholstery businesses. The order also allows those that rent boats, golf carts, kayaks and ATVs to reopen.

Quote:“I’m not glad an unelected bureaucrat thinks she has this unchecked power to tell people they can’t go to work.”

Sortwell’s tweet underscores increased criticism from GOP lawmakers over Palm’s handling of the virus, with some in the Senate going so far as to call for her firing. Senate Republicans have yet to confirm Palm’s appointment.
Senate Majority Leader Scott Fitzgerald, R-Juneau, over the weekend told WISN-TV that Senate Republicans have asked Palm to speak before the health committee and answer questions pertaining to the “safer at home” order and data it is based on.

“Hopefully that will happen soon,” Fitzgerald told WISN, “because I think there is some concern about how the secretary is managing the situation right now.”
